Phillies, Jackson Rutledge Agree To Minor League Deal

The Phillies re-signed reliever Jackson Rutledge on a minor league contract, according to the MLB.com transaction tracker. He was assigned back to Triple-A Lehigh Valley, where he’ll go on the injured list. Philadelphia released Rutledge last week, a few days after he was designated for assignment to open a roster spot for Derek Hill. That was […]

The Washington Nationals scratched shortstop CJ Abrams from Tuesday night’s matchup vs. the Philadelphia Phillies because of left side tightness. The late change came shortly before first pitch, creating a notable absence for the Nationals in a key NL East matchup.
